At God’s Love We Deliver’s Golden Heart Awards in New York City on Monday, the Asteroid City star was asked whether or not she and husband Colin Jost were “tackling the Terrible Twos” with their 2-year-old son Cosmo. “I think the ‘Terrible Twos’ are more like tackling me! Like, actually physically tackling me,” she quipped to Entertainment Tonight.

Johansson, who is also mom to Rose, 9, from a previous relationship, previously shared how much Cosmo is talking. The Avengers star told ETback in June: “My son is very talkative. He’s not yet 2, but he did tell me the other day that his clothing was all wet. And I was like, ‘Did you just say clothing?!’”
“Yeah, he’s very verbose,” she added.
Although things may be difficult right now with a toddler, Johansson does have experience navigating this age. In a 2017 appearance on The Skinny Confidential Him & Her Podcast, the actress compared raising a toddler to “being in an emotionally abusive relationship,” per PEOPLE.
“It’s really tough,” she said. “I remember my daughter when she was 2, I said, ‘This is great. I don’t know what everybody is talking about.’ And then she turned 3, and it’s like being in an emotionally abusive relationship.”
Johansson added, “It’s just so intense. No reasoning. Very intense emotional swings and like, so bossy and adamant, and it’s just crazy.”
